An open tank, measuring 4 m long by 2 wide by by 1.5 m high, is filled with water to a depth of 1 m as shown in Figure 2. The tank is being towed by a truck on a level road in the positive y direction. 4 m 1.5 m 1 m. A Water Figure 2 Determine the maximum acceleration if no water spillage is allowed during towing. (i) If the tank were to be towed on an uphill road that makes an angle of 10° with the horizontal, determine the maximum acceleration if water spillage is to be avoided

Explanation / Answer

At the condition of limiting spillage,
tan=a/g

so, 1.5/4=a/g

1)a=0.375g= 3.75 m/sec2

2) tan= acos10/(g+asin10)

1.5/4= 0.984a/(10+0.174a)

a=4.07 m/sec2
